The beginning
Lacoste Essential Sport arrived as the brand continued translating its athletic DNA into fragrance. The composition built around citrus brightness, green freshness, and a woody drydown that held the skin. The opening delivers an immediate burst of lemon and bergamot that feels clean and energizing, like the first breath of morning air. As it settles, the heart opens into something warmer, a subtle interplay of spice and herbal notes that give the scent depth without heaviness. The ginger adds a bright, slightly piquant quality that cuts through the citrus while allowing the green notes to remain present. Nutmeg contributes a soft, velvety warmth that rounds out the edges and prevents the composition from feeling too sharp.
What sets Essential Sport apart is the ginger-nutmeg axis in the heart. The fragrance builds mid-palette warmth that gives the scent a sense of body and presence. Ginger adds a bright, slightly spicy quality that cuts through the citrus while nutmeg brings a soft, warm complexity that rounds out the edges. These two notes work together to create an unexpected depth that distinguishes this fragrance from simpler sport scents. The green notes and water accord keep the top clean and refreshing; the vetiver and patchouli base keeps it grounded and substantial.
The evolution
The opening arrives bright. Grapefruit and bergamot hit the skin with the kind of immediate clarity that makes you stand straighter. Ginger adds a clean heat underneath, spice without fire. Within 20 minutes the citrus softens and the heart takes over. Juniper and green notes introduce a cooler, almost mineral quality. A subtle aquatic accord moves in, not oceanic or synthetic, but the suggestion of water against skin. The drydown is where Essential Sport earns its name. Vetiver and patchouli settle into the skin, the musk keeping everything close. By hour three the fragrance is intimate, present but not projecting, comfortable in that way a well-worn t-shirt is comfortable. It doesn't announce itself. It stays.
Cultural impact
Lacoste Essential Sport arrived when the sport aquatic genre had grown familiar. Rather than following the established path, it staked its identity on an unexpected ingredient: ginger. This bold move distinguished it from fragrances that relied purely on marine and citrus combinations. The fragrance tapped into a growing cultural moment where casual athletics and everyday wellness were becoming mainstream. Its popularity has endured because it occupies a specific niche, more aggressive than an office freshie, yet more refined than a pure gym scent.
